Dyno Run on Just built 1991 Civic EX With ITR Motor
John at Inline Pro was nice enough to dyno my car today which is a 1991 Civic EX with ITR shortblock (jdm b18c) with usdm ITR head and '98 ITR oem cams run on pr3 obd0 computer with apex vtec controller and stock injectors.
I have a b16a manifold with '99 si aem intake & only mediocre results (which leaves lots of room for improvement) :
177.6 hp @ 7350 rpm
128.4 tq @ 5300 rpm
This was at 86 F and about 90% humidity...

i used a stock itr tb (64 mm) and had 2.5 in. exhaust at muffler shop with magnaflow muffler...i sorta handported the inlet to the b16 manifold so it would not have the stepoff down in size from the tb....header was stock jdm itr 4:1 with wrap and the two o2 bungs welded about 5 in. downstream from the header flange

Peak should come at 8000 so your topend is suffering somewhat
Cam gears will net you some gains and imrove the mid range by a quite a bit...I gained about +18 and +18ftlbs @5200 by playing with my cam gears and resetting the VTEC to 4800 and modifying the fuel a little.
